Abstract

547,761. Optical apparatus. JOHNSON, E. R. F. July 3, 1941, No. 8412. Convention date, Oct. 26, 1940. [Class 97 (i)] Means enabling submerged objects to be viewed or photographed through the window of a diving bell, aquarium &c. with reduced distortion and refraction effects, comprises an auxiliary window movable with the viewer or camera so as to remain perpendicular to the optical axis, and means for maintaining between the two windows a medium having substantially the same refractive index as the medium in which the object is submerged. As shown a frame 15 is held tightly against a window 11 by bolts in the wall 10 and by nuts. A frame 21 is mounted on vertical pivots 19, 20 in the frame 15 and carries horizontal pivots 26 on which a frame 27, carrying an auxiliary window 42 and a camera 31, is adjustably mounted. A flexible bellows 45 is secured to the window 42, and between the frame 15 and the window 11, to form a liquid chamber which is connected to a tank 48 receiving liquid displaced by movement of the window 42. The camera may be replaced by a facehood for viewing, or the window 42 may be carried by the camera and the bellows be secured to the window 11 by a suction ring. For curved windows the bellows may be secured to the surrounding wall ; the liquid may be coloured to form a light filter.
